Output 944d2143efbba1aeec434e830150b56d35e2ca1478a751be491c0e1a83afda07:2

value
86876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f291677dd6da34b48018695bea6652b5a68b681 OP_EQUAL
address
3K7nD1chVGQ5EG7DvT7Zkrr2Hq4h3a4ZX3
transaction
944d2143efbba1aeec434e830150b56d35e2ca1478a751be491c0e1a83afda07
confirmations
211146
spent
true